{"title":"Jane Pillow Futcher","description":"Jane Futcher is the author of \"Crush,\" \"Promise Not to Tell,\" \"Dream Lover,\" \"Marin: The Place, The People,\" and \"Women Gone Wild,\" a memoir about moving to northern Mendocino County, California, where she lives. She grew up in Baltimore, MD. She earned a B.A. in English from Dickinson College in Carlisle, CA, in 1969, and an M.A. in Creative Writing from Boston University in 1970. She worked in the Media Department of Harper \u0026amp; Row, Publishers, Inc, from 1973 to 1977, before moving to Northern California in 1977. She wrote CRUSH in San Francisco. The novel was first published in 1981 for young adults and adults. Futcher has worked as a journalist, English teacher, massage therapist and freelance writer. She lives on 160 acres in rural Mendocino County. Her short stories have appeared in numerous anthologies, including BUSHFIRE, HOT TICKET and LESBIAN ADVENTURE STORIES.","products":[],"url":"https:\/\/blackandbarhe.com\/collections\/jane-pillow-futcher.oembed","provider":"Black \u0026 Barhe Bookstore","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
